What Is Zoom Teeth Whitening?:
Zoom Teeth Whitening is a professional in-office treatment performed by a dentist. It uses a potent hydrogen peroxide-based whitening gel and a special light to accelerate the whitening process. Zoom Teeth Whitening is known for its effectiveness, with visible results achieved in just one session. This treatment is perfect for individuals seeking a fast, dramatic improvement in their smile.
How Does Zoom Teeth Whitening Work?:
Here’s a step-by-step breakdown of the procedure:
- Consultation and Preparation: Your dentist will assess your teeth and gums to ensure they’re healthy enough for whitening. A protective gel is applied to your gums, and a whitening gel is applied to your teeth.
- Application of Whitening Gel: The whitening gel is activated by a special light, which accelerates the whitening process. The gel penetrates deep into the enamel to break down stains and discoloration.
- Multiple Sessions: Typically, the procedure lasts around 60-90 minutes, with the gel being reapplied every 15 minutes.
- Post-Treatment Care: After the treatment, your dentist will offer tips to maintain your whiter smile and minimize sensitivity.
What Is Traditional Teeth Whitening?:
Traditional whitening methods refer to at-home treatments, such as whitening toothpaste, over-the-counter gels, strips, or trays. These options are more affordable and convenient for those who prefer a DIY approach to teeth whitening. However, they are typically less potent than professional treatments, requiring weeks of consistent use for noticeable results.
How Do Traditional Whitening Methods Work?:
Traditional at-home whitening options generally involve the following:
- Whitening Toothpastes: These contain mild abrasives and chemicals that help remove surface stains over time. They are the most gentle whitening option but often require consistent use for several weeks to see results.
- Whitening Strips: These thin plastic strips are coated with a whitening gel and are applied directly to the teeth. They are generally used for 30 minutes to an hour daily over a couple of weeks.
- Whitening Trays and Gels: Custom-made trays or pre-filled trays are worn over the teeth with a whitening gel for a specific duration each day or night, typically for a week or more.
Key Differences Between Zoom Teeth Whitening and Traditional Whitening:
There are several factors to consider when choosing between Zoom Teeth Whitening in Dubai and traditional at-home treatments. Here’s a detailed comparison of both methods:
1. Effectiveness and Results:
- Zoom Teeth Whitening: The results from Zoom Whitening are immediate and dramatic. You can expect to see your teeth lightened by several shades after just one session.
- Traditional Whitening: Traditional methods can take weeks to produce noticeable results. Whitening toothpaste may take up to several weeks, while strips or trays can take 7-14 days of daily use to show a visible difference.
2. Speed of Treatment:
- Zoom Teeth Whitening: One of the key advantages of Zoom Whitening is speed. The procedure takes between 60 to 90 minutes, allowing you to achieve a noticeably whiter smile in a single visit.
- Traditional Whitening: At-home treatments require daily application over an extended period. For example, whitening strips may need to be applied for 30 minutes each day for 2-3 weeks to see results.
3. Convenience and Comfort:
- Zoom Teeth Whitening: While Zoom Whitening is quick, it requires a visit to the dentist’s office. Some individuals may experience mild sensitivity during or after the procedure.
- Traditional Whitening: At-home methods offer greater convenience since you can use them in the comfort of your home, though the application process can be time-consuming. There may also be a slight risk of uneven results or gum irritation with poorly fitted trays.
4. Cost:
- Zoom Teeth Whitening: The cost of Zoom Teeth Whitening in Dubai typically ranges from AED 1,500 to AED 2,500 per session. While it is a more expensive option upfront, the results are long-lasting and you only need one session.
- Traditional Whitening: At-home treatments are much more affordable, with whitening toothpaste and strips costing significantly less. Custom whitening trays can cost more but still remain relatively cheaper than professional treatments.
5. Long-Term Results:
- Zoom Teeth Whitening: Results from Zoom Whitening are long-lasting with proper maintenance. You can maintain your whiter smile for several months, depending on your lifestyle choices.
- Traditional Whitening: The results from traditional whitening are less durable. Stains may begin to reappear after a few months, and touch-up treatments are typically required to maintain the whiteness.
